    looks like someone who was employed by the Reds organization received a presentation bat from Adirondack after they won the WS in '75 and rather than keep it in its original state, cut it in two (ugh!) and made a trophy out of it.

    perhaps a Reds 1975 Media Guide can provide insight on who this prson was.

    i know your buddy wasn't thinking of selling it, but I don't think it has a whole lot of value (particularly in it's present state).

    obviously unique!

    Looks like one of those Adirondacks presentations WS bats which was sawed in half and mounted on the trophy base with a similar plate. I've seen these type of presentation bats (full bat) before but never mounted on a base like that. Perhaps the full bat was cut in half and mounted after the fact for display purposes.
